The city will diversify the use of investment instruments to avoid incurring unreasonable risks inherent in over-investing in specific instruments, individual financial institutions or maturities. With the following exceptions no more than 50% of the city's total investment portfolio will be invested in a single security type or with a single financial institution:
(A) United States Treasury Securities;
(B) United States Government Agency Securities and Instrumentalities of Government Sponsored Corporations, the principal and interest of which are unconditionally guaranteed by the United States;
(C) Fully Collateralized Certificate of Deposit; and
(D) State Treasury Asset Reserve of Ohio. (Ord. 2973, passed 4-11-95)
